The Last Horror Film is a 1982 slasher film directed by David Winters. The movie follows a mentally unstable New York taxi driver named Vinny Durand (played by Joe Spinell) as he stalks a beautiful actress named Jana Bates (played by Caroline Munro) attending the Cannes Film Festival, hoping to convince her to star in his own horror movie.

Vinny relentlessly pursues Jana, even going as far as sneaking into her hotel room and following her to various events. However, as Vinny's obsession intensifies, a series of violent murders occur around Jana and her friends at the festival. It becomes apparent that someone is targeting those close to Jana, and suspicion falls on Vinny as a possible suspect.

Throughout the movie, the audience is left to wonder if Vinny is the culprit behind the killings or if it is just a coincidence that they coincide with his stalking of Jana. As tensions rise and the body count increases, the suspense builds towards a shocking finale.

The Last Horror Film is known for its unique premise and the unsettling performance by Joe Spinell. The film was not a commercial success upon its release but has gained a cult following over the years, particularly for its portrayal of the Cannes Film Festival and the horror genre.
